Advisors Asset Management’s ACT-Navellier/Dial High Income Opportunities Portfolios Celebrate 10-Year Anniversary
MONUMENT, COLO. — June 18, 2019 — Advisors Asset Management (AAM) a leading provider of income-focused solutions that financial advisors utilize to help meet client needs and expand their businesses, announced that its ACT-Navellier/Dial High Income Opportunities Portfolios is celebrating their 10-year anniversary this June.
The ACT- Navellier/Dial High Income Opportunities Portfolios are unit investment trusts (UITs) that offer investors the opportunity to earn competitive yields from a variety of investment-grade bonds. The portfolios were selected by Navellier & Associates, Inc. with assistance from Dial Capital Management, LLC.
"When we partnered with AAM a decade ago to launch this strategy, we sought to provide investors with affordable access to investment-grade corporate bonds while offering the potential for a consistent stream of income," said Louis Navellier, Chief Investment Officer and CEO of Navellier & Associates, portfolio consultant.
The ACT-Navellier/Dial High Income Opportunities Portfolios provides investors with the opportunity to own a variety of investment grade corporate bonds. Creating the same portfolio may be difficult and/ or expensive for individual investors to achieve on their own. The permanence and definition of a UIT provides full transparency of the underlying bonds. Investors know the exact securities initially included in the portfolio, when the UIT is scheduled to mature, and what income stream the UIT is expected to generate.
"We’ve remained disciplined in our investment approach during the strategy’s tenure, focusing on using a systematic method to identify opportunities while attempting to limit investor risk,” said Richard Stewart, CFA, Executive Vice President, UITs at AAM. “With the continued low-interest rate environment, UITs can be an attractive option for advisors seeking income during their client’s retirement as duration risk remains top-of-mind."
About Advisors Asset Management
For 40 years, AAM has been a trusted resource for financial advisors and broker/dealers. It offers access to UITs (unit investment trusts), open- and closed-end mutual funds, separately managed accounts (SMAs), structured products, the fixed income markets, portfolio analytics and now exchange-traded funds (ETFs).
